The core plugins are maintained / developed by the official development team.Ībbreviations Code::Blocks AutoComplete plugin.Īutosave Saves project files between intervals.Ĭlass Wizard Provides wizard for creating new classes.Ĭode Completion Provides code completion functionality and class browser.ĬB Clangd Client Provides code completion functionality and class browser by Clangd through LSP.Ĭompiler Provides support for various compilers in one interface.ĭebugger Provides support for various debuggers in one interface.įile Extensions Handler Adds extra file extension handlers. The core plugins are installed by default and offer the basic functions of Code::Blocks.

Theses plugins often have their own repository or are being posted (including the source code) in the forums. 3rd party plugins - developed and maintained by the community but not (yet?) in the C::B repository.So they are integrated into the C::B SVN. Contrib plugins - developed and maintained by the community and proven to be very valuable.Core plugins - developed and maintained by the core C::B team.
